English

We will be writing our own instructions for growing cress. We will be writing as independently, practising using all of the things that we have learnt including capital letters, full stops, finger spaces and conjunctions (and, but). 

 

In phonics, we will be reviewing the following sounds in preparation for the phonics screening check:

 

i /igh/ as in tiger

a /ai/ as in paper

ow /oa/ as in snow

u /yoo/ as in unicorn

 

The tricky words we will focus on this half term will be:

two      eye       thought      through         friend

 

Don’t forget to review the sounds and tricky words in the front of the reading records whenever you read with your child.

Maths

We will be continuing to learn about fractions this week. We are learning to recognise, find and make a quarter of objects and shapes. We will also be doing the same for quantities by completing simple problems.  

Topic

In geography we will be looking at aerial photos of the local area and also making maps of our school.

 

In Art we will be continuing to explore Gaudi and creating our own buildings by using a mosaic style. 

 

In DT we will be designing and making our own smoothies.

 

In science we will be continuing to learn about flowers through our flower festival.
